Understanding DayQuil Severe and Its Ingredients

DayQuil Severe is a popular over-the-counter medication designed to alleviate multiple cold and flu symptoms such as nasal congestion, cough, fever, and body aches. Unlike its nighttime counterpart, NyQuil, DayQuil Severe is specifically marketed as a non-drowsy formula. But what exactly goes into this medication that helps it avoid causing sleepiness?

The key active ingredients in DayQuil Severe typically include:

    • Acetaminophen: A pain reliever and fever reducer.
    • Dextromethorphan HBr: A cough suppressant.
    • Phenylephrine HCl: A nasal decongestant.

These components work together to target symptoms without the sedative effects commonly found in other cold medicines. Unlike ingredients such as diphenhydramine or doxylamine, which are antihistamines known for causing drowsiness, DayQuil Severe’s formula avoids these sedatives.

The Role of Phenylephrine in Alertness

Phenylephrine is a stimulant that constricts blood vessels in the nasal passages to reduce swelling and congestion. This vasoconstriction can have a mild stimulating effect on the central nervous system. As a result, phenylephrine may actually promote wakefulness rather than sleepiness.

This is why many users report feeling more alert or even slightly jittery after taking DayQuil Severe. The stimulant properties of phenylephrine contrast sharply with the sedating effects of antihistamines found in nighttime cold remedies.

Does DayQuil Severe Make You Sleepy? The Science Behind It

The question “Does DayQuil Severe Make You Sleepy?” arises frequently because many cold medications cause drowsiness. However, the scientific basis behind DayQuil Severe’s formulation points toward minimal to no sedative effects.

Acetaminophen works primarily on pain pathways and fever reduction without influencing the central nervous system in a way that causes sedation. Dextromethorphan suppresses cough reflexes but also doesn’t typically cause drowsiness at recommended doses.

Phenylephrine’s stimulating nature further reduces any likelihood of sleepiness. In fact, some people might find it harder to fall asleep due to this ingredient’s mild stimulant effect.

That said, individual reactions can vary based on metabolism, dosage, and sensitivity to medications. While most people remain alert after taking DayQuil Severe, a small minority might experience fatigue or mild sedation due to personal differences or interactions with other drugs.

Comparing DayQuil Severe with NyQuil

NyQuil contains ingredients like doxylamine succinate—a first-generation antihistamine known for its strong sedative properties—making it effective for nighttime relief but unsuitable for daytime use if one needs to stay awake.

Here’s a quick comparison table highlighting key differences:

Ingredient DayQuil Severe NyQuil
Acetaminophen Yes (Pain/fever relief) Yes (Pain/fever relief)
Dextromethorphan HBr (Cough Suppressant) Yes Yes
Nasal Decongestant Phenylephrine HCl (Stimulating) No decongestant or Phenylephrine absent
Antihistamine (Sedating) No Doxylamine Succinate (Sedating)
Drowsiness Effect No (non-drowsy) Yes (causes sleepiness)

This comparison underlines why DayQuil Severe is preferred during daytime hours when maintaining alertness is crucial.

The Impact of Individual Factors on Sleepiness from DayQuil Severe

While the official stance and ingredient profile suggest that DayQuil Severe does not cause sleepiness, there are exceptions worth noting.

Sensitivity and Allergies

Some individuals may have heightened sensitivity to certain ingredients like acetaminophen or dextromethorphan. Though these are generally non-sedating at therapeutic doses, unusual reactions can occur. Allergic responses or adverse effects might manifest as fatigue or sluggishness.

Drug Interactions

If you’re taking other medications—especially those with sedative effects like benzodiazepines, opioids, or certain antidepressants—combining them with DayQuil Severe could amplify drowsiness. It’s essential to consult a healthcare provider before mixing medicines.

Dose and Overuse

Taking more than the recommended dose can lead to unexpected side effects including dizziness or fatigue. Overuse of acetaminophen also risks liver damage but can cause systemic symptoms like malaise that may feel like tiredness.
